Formula: Ag3AsS3
Origin of name: for J. Proust, French chemist
Crystal system: hexagonal
Crystal class: 3m
Twinning: common on {10-14} trillings, also common on {10-11}, on {0001} or {01-12}
Unit cell: a = 10.96 Å, c = 8.61 Å
Colour: scarlet red to vermillion red
Diaphaneity:
Luster: adamantine to submetallic
Habit: crystals prismatic, rhombohedral or scalenohedral, highly modified, massive, compact, disseminated
Hardness: 2 to 2.5
Specific gravity: 5.55 to 5.64
Cleavage: 1; {10-11} distinct
Tenacity: conchoidal to uneven, brittle
Streak: bright red
Synonyms/varieties: ruby silver
Comments: dimorphous with xanthoconite
